High-resolution spectroscopy of the young open cluster M 39 (NGC 7092)
Vallenari, A.; Bragaglia, A.; Frasca, A. +5 more
M 39 is a nearby young open cluster hardly studied in the last few decades. No giant is known among its members and its chemical composition has never been studied. Low-amplitude Solar-like Oscillations in the K5 V Star ϵ Indi A
Butler, R. Paul; Li, Yaguang; Bedding, Timothy R. +17 more
We have detected solar-like oscillations in the mid-K-dwarf ϵ Indi A, making it the coolest dwarf to have measured oscillations. The star is noteworthy for harboring a pair of brown dwarf companions and a Jupiter-type planet.
